Output e8c5311ec8981009005024c7a9299bba0680daf44ad0dfaf1392053765a6523f:1

value
638864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e92cfbe007de09d3e096abbdc14f5e8a7fbb705b OP_EQUAL
address
3NwwFmw6U2cCcmC5YXq9QU9TFtT1jX6LLe
transaction
e8c5311ec8981009005024c7a9299bba0680daf44ad0dfaf1392053765a6523f
spent
true